Richard Sherman is still working on unblocking fans on Twitter

He’s trying to get this straightened out. We’ll spread the word.

Back in March, we were coming up with ways to help 49ers cornerback Richard Sherman unblock the numerous accounts he blocked over the years when he was with the Seattle Seahawks. We first came up with a list to present, then Sherman offered amnesty if you made a donation to his charity, Blanket Coverage.

Well it’s May and there may still be a few people listed as blocked. Sherman tweeted this out on Sunday if anyone is still needing a lift on their status:

If you or some friends are blocked, there’s your avenue. I can’t imagine how hard it is to do a bulk unblocking, but I’m guessing it’s going to take Sherman some time to get everyone squared away.

One word of warning, just because Sherman is giving you a clean slate doesn’t mean he won’t slap a block right back on you if you once again do whatever it was that got you blocked in the first place. Best to keep that in mind.
